The Michigan Tests for Teacher Certification (MTTC) are standardized tests administered by the Michigan Department of Education (MDE) designed to assess the knowledge and skills of individuals seeking certification as educators in the state of Michigan. The ParaPro Assessment is a general aptitude test for prospective and practicing paraprofessionals that measures your: skills and knowledge in reading, writing and math. ability to apply them when assisting in classroom instruction. The California Subject Examinations for Teachers (CSET) is a series of exams designed specifically for aspiring teachers planning on teaching in the state of California. All MTTC tests are now administered through computer-based testing (CBT) by appointment only. Most are available year-round, Monday through Saturday (excluding some holidays), at test centers throughout the United States, its territories, and Canada, including 12 or more locations in Michigan. As per the Right to Education Act, qualifying TET is the minimum eligibility criterion for appointment as a teacher in an Indian school. These exams for teachers are divided into two categories. Candidates can apply to one or both tests.
